- Ethie Mains, Great Britain
- https://rice-oddershede-2.mdwrite.net/what-tilt-and-turn-windows-will-be-your-next-big-obsession
-
Upgrade your home with expert Local Tilt And Turn Window Installation services. Enhance your space with quality windows that combine style and functionality. Schedule your installation today!
- Joined on
2025-11-08
Block a user
Sort